Ordinals
beta
Sat 148199750063809
decimal
5241.70950063809
percentile
0.296399500127618%
name
mocpwcfwbmkm
cycle
0
epoch
2
block
5241
offset
70950063809
timestamp
2023-12-11 18:52:28 UTC
rarity
common
prev
next